Classical violinist performs for Wilson and Rodriguez students

 

The sounds of classical music captivated students at Wilson and Rodriguez Elementary School on Jan. 31.

Ann Fontanella, a solo violinist, and pianist Jo Jiang treated Wilson and Rodriguez students to a special performance on both campuses. Fontanella and Jiang entertained the audience with a showcase of diverse classics.

Throughout the performances, Fontanella provided a description of the composer and time period of the song she was set to play. Students watched carefully until Fontenalla welcomed any questions the students had. Students anxiously held their hands up for their questions to be selected. Questions ranged from the amount of hours she practice a day to the materials her instrument was made out of.

The Harlingen Concert Association (HCA), who sponsors musical events around the community, brought down the soloist as a way to showcase quality entertainment to young minds. The Harlingen Consolidated Independent School District Music Department worked with HCA to arrange the concerts for the campuses.

With the showcase, their charge is to promote musical interest and encourage students to join music programs. For the students at Rodriguez and Wilson, the performance was a perfect way to emphasize music in its many forms.

This is the second HCA sponsored performance with HCISD. The Abram Brothers, a bluegrass trio from Canada, performed for Gutierrez Middle School and Dishman Elementary School students on Jan. 11.
